Geological Insights: Understanding the Dynamics of the Soufriere Hills Volcano Eruption
The ongoing eruption of the Soufriere Hills volcano continues to draw the attention of geologists and disaster management agencies alike due to its complex volcanic dynamics. The recent activity has revealed significant insights into the magma movement, which is characterized by a mix of explosive eruptions and lava dome growth. Researchers have observed that the composition of the erupted materials exhibits variations, indicating a dynamic interplay of different magma batches. The volcano’s behavior is closely monitored through a network of seismic and gas emission sensors, which play a critical role in predicting potential hazards and assessing the volcano’s eruptive timeline.
Furthermore, the interaction between the volcanic activity and the geological formation of the surrounding terrain has been a focal point of study. The eruption has led to further understanding of lahar generation, which poses a considerable risk to the nearby communities. Key factors influencing this phenomenon include:
- Rainfall intensity: Increased precipitation can trigger mudflows.
- Topographic features: The landscape heavily influences the path and speed of lahars.
- Volcanic material composition: The type of materials ejected affects lability.
